Identification of Deceased Hostages

On October 13, 2025, Israel confirmed the receipt of the bodies of four deceased hostages from Hamas as part of the final phase of hostage exchanges. This rare event marked one of the few instances where Hamas returned deceased individuals rather than living captives. Israeli authorities promptly identified two of the hostages and released forensic details concerning their deaths, providing some closure to grieving families.

The identification process was conducted by Israeli medical and forensic teams, who have been pivotal in ensuring accurate and transparent communication with the public. The return of these bodies underscores the complexity and emotional toll of the hostage crisis, which has been a recurring theme in the ongoing Israeli-Palestinian conflict.

Implications of the Hostage Return

The exchange and identification of deceased hostages have sparked renewed public debate on the tactics used in negotiations with Hamas. The event has highlighted the broader implications for Israeli society and the need for a transparent, accountable process in handling such sensitive situations. There is a growing call within Israel for a reassessment of negotiation strategies and military operations to prevent future crises of this magnitude.

Simultaneously, the return of bodies has emotional significance for the families involved, providing a sense of closure after years of uncertainty and distress. However, questions remain about the circumstances of the deaths, with Hamas claiming they resulted from Israeli military actions, while Israeli forensic teams suggest alternative causes.
